Registration is compulsory once your aggregate turnover crosses the threshold for your state and category, and immediately — with no threshold at all — in several situations: interstate supply of goods, supply through an e-commerce operator, liability under reverse charge, and the casual and non-resident cases.
The application itself is short. What decides how quickly it clears is the address proof, the correct principal place of business, the right HSN or SAC selection, and how the clarification notice is answered if one comes. We would rather tell you registration is not required than register you into a monthly return you did not need.

What you supply
- PAN of the business and of the proprietor, partners or directors
- Aadhaar of the authorised signatory, with the linked mobile and email
- Photograph of the proprietor, partners or directors
- Proof of principal place of business — ownership document, rent agreement, or NOC from the owner
- A recent electricity bill or property tax receipt for the premises
- Bank account details — cancelled cheque or a statement showing name and IFSC
- Certificate of incorporation, partnership deed or LLP agreement, as applicable
- Board resolution or authorisation letter for the signatory, for companies and LLPs
Address proof is what holds up most applications. If the premises are rented and the agreement is not in the business's name, tell us early — it usually needs a NOC rather than a new agreement.

Questions we are asked about this
What is the turnover threshold?
It depends on what you supply and where. Broadly, goods carry a higher threshold than services, and the special category states are lower. But several categories have to register from the first rupee regardless of turnover, so turnover alone does not settle it — we check the category first.
How long does registration take?
Where Aadhaar authentication succeeds and documents are clean, it is usually a matter of days. Physical verification of premises, or a clarification notice, extends it. Anyone promising a fixed number of days without seeing your address proof is guessing.
Do I need separate registration for each state?
Yes. GST registration is state-wise, so a place of business in another state means a separate registration there. Additional premises within the same state are added to the existing registration as additional places of business.
I sell on Amazon and Flipkart. Is registration compulsory?
Supplying through an e-commerce operator that collects tax at source requires registration irrespective of turnover for most sellers. There is a narrow relaxation for certain small suppliers, which we will check against your actual activity.
